    This is a kiosk on a random corner next to a barber shop just west of I-15 in the Normal Heights neighborhood. I believe a previous bubble tea vendor operated out of this shack before Boba Monkey did. The menu offered iced coffee, matcha, milk tea, slushes, and specialty drinks in regular and large sizes. For a place with minimal overhead costs, the prices were high with a range from $6.50 to $8.50. Toppings were $1 or $2 apiece. From the list of five Milk Teas, I picked a large size of the first one which was the namesake Boba Monkey Milk Tea. I requested less ice, normal sugar, and the addition of boba pearls. The cup was a 20 oz serving, and the total was over $10 after tax and gratuity. I didn't find this milk tea to be anything more than ordinary. There wasn't a strong tea flavor, and the boba pearls were average for chewiness. You may also have to drive around the side streets before locating a curbside spot if the ones directly in front were occupied. For the quality and cost of the product I tried, I gave a generous three star rating for Boba Monkey.
